One of the frontrunners was The Power of the Dog. Directed by Jane Campion, this Western psychological drama captivated audiences with its breathtaking cinematography and powerful performances. The film explored themes of masculinity, repression, and the complexities of human relationships in a stunningly beautiful setting. The film was celebrated for its nuanced portrayal of complex characters and its exploration of the darker aspects of the human psyche. Then there was Belfast, Kenneth Branagh's semi-autobiographical coming-of-age story set against the backdrop of the Troubles in Northern Ireland. This film offered a poignant and heartwarming glimpse into the lives of ordinary people caught up in extraordinary circumstances. The film was praised for its authenticity, its emotional depth, and its ability to capture the innocence of childhood in the face of adversity. And don't forget CODA, a heartwarming story about a hearing daughter of deaf parents pursuing her passion for music. This film was a critical and commercial success, celebrated for its authentic portrayal of a deaf family and its message of inclusivity. This movie was a testament to the power of family, love, and the pursuit of dreams. Best Actor went to Will Smith for his performance in King Richard. Smith's portrayal of Richard Williams, the determined father of tennis superstars Venus and Serena Williams, was both powerful and moving. His performance was filled with passion, dedication, and a deep understanding of the character. Smith's ability to embody the character's strength, vulnerability, and unwavering love for his daughters was truly remarkable, making the movie feel so real. Smith's performance demonstrated his range and solidified his status as one of Hollywood's leading actors.
In the Best Actress category, Jessica Chastain took home the Oscar for her performance in The Eyes of Tammy Faye. Chastain's transformation into the eccentric televangelist Tammy Faye Bakker was nothing short of extraordinary. Her performance was a masterclass in acting, showcasing her ability to capture the character's unique quirks, vulnerabilities, and unwavering faith. Chastain's ability to embody the character's spirit and convey her message of love and acceptance was truly inspiring. Her dedication to the role was evident in every scene.
Behind the camera, the Best Director award went to Jane Campion for The Power of the Dog. Campion's work on the film was a testament to her vision and storytelling abilities. Her direction was precise and nuanced, creating a cinematic masterpiece that captivated audiences around the world. Campion's ability to bring out the best in her cast and crew was evident in every frame of the film. Her success served as an inspiration to aspiring filmmakers everywhere. Drive My Car was a standout in the International Feature Film category. This Japanese film, directed by Ryusuke Hamaguchi, tells a touching story of grief, loss, and the healing power of art. Drive My Car is a testament to the power of storytelling, using a simple premise to explore complex themes with grace and beauty. It's a beautifully made film.
Encanto also made waves, winning Best Animated Feature. This vibrant and heartwarming film brought a story of family, magic, and self-discovery. Encanto captured the hearts of audiences of all ages, celebrating diversity and the importance of embracing one's unique qualities. It's a colorful and charming movie for the whole family!
